win安装使用gevent

协程的适用场景:当程序中存在大量不需要CPU的操作时(IO)

from gevent import monkey; monkey.patch_all()
import gevent
import requests

def f(url):
    print(‘GET: %s‘ % url)
    resp = requests.get(url)
    data = resp.text
    print(len(data))

gevent.joinall([
        gevent.spawn(f, ‘https://www.python.org/‘),
        gevent.spawn(f, ‘https://www.yahoo.com/‘),
        gevent.spawn(f, ‘https://github.com/‘),
])

gevent是第三方库,win下不能使用pip等快速安装,必须从https://pypi.python.org/pypi/gevent/#downloads下载安装,在下载文件目录下,使用 命令:pip install xxx.whl

即可。

时间: 2024-10-11 00:45:06

win安装使用gevent的相关文章

Python 环境搭建(Win 安装以及Mac OS 安装)

千里之行始于足下,今天我们先来学习 Python 环境搭建. 注意:本系列教程基于 Python 3.X Python 环境搭建 Win 安装 打开 Python 官网 https://www.python.org/downloads/选择最新版本下载,或者直接打开对应的版本python-374(https://www.python.org/downloads/release/python-374/). 打开页面会看到有一个列表,如下图: x86是32位,x86-64是64位. 可以通过下面3种

win 安装plsql 连接远程oracle

由于本人不想安装oracle客户端/oracle服务端 ,所以在虚机 linux上安装oracle服务端后,实现在win只是安装pl/sql连接远程oracle. 1.下载pl/sql工具安装(我的是32位) 2.下载instantclient-basic-win32-11.2.0.1.0.zip 3.解压instantclient-basic-win32-11.2.0.1.0.zip后,将在oracle服务器上下载tnsnames.ora,修改HOST 4.配置环境变量 变量名        

关于yaf 框架的win安装

http://www.sunqinglin.cn/index.php/archives/329.html PHP windows下yaf框架的安装和配置 2014年10月28日 ⁄ PHP, 编程开发 ⁄ 共 2234字 ⁄ 字号 小 中 大 ⁄ 暂无评论 首先YAF框架是一个非常不错优秀的框架,全称 Yet Another Framework,它是一个C语言写的一个框架,是一个以PHP扩展形式提供的PHP开发框架, 相比于一般的PHP框架, 它更快,更轻便. 它提供了Bootstrap, 路由

WCP知识库 开源版 Win安装配置

最近正在一直为公司项目组寻找一个免费开源好配置.界面还清新的知识库程序.找来找去,最后在OSCHINA找到一个推荐. WCP知识库.不过,此开源项目对于Win版相当不友好.如何配置的文档都没有.甚是讨厌.我最后还是成功的安装了.以下是安装方法. 前期准备: 1.Windows:2008 R2 2.WCP源程序 步骤:

win安装mysql5.1

win7装mysql 一 下载 http://vdisk.weibo.com/s/Ae4yZ_pySewp ? 二 安装配置 ?

win安装NLTK出现的问题

一.今天学习Python自然语言处理(NLP processing) 需要安装自然语言工具包NLTK Natural Language Toolkit 按照教程在官网https://pypi.python.org/pypi/nltk#downloads下载的EXE文件运行,电脑出现缺少: api-ms-win-crt-string-l1-1-0.dll,然后在网上下载该dll文件安装后发现还是不能运行,出现应用程序无法正常启动(0x000007b).错误 二.用pip安装nltk 于是尝试pip

win 安装mysql

windows上安装sql最容易出现 1067错误,网上查了很多,大部分都是误导.现在将验证过的步骤总结如下: 1.下载mysql,我用的是mysql-5.6.24-win32 下载后解压,进入到bin目录,修改配置文件.修改如下: # For advice on how to change settings please see # http://dev.mysql.com/doc/refman/5.6/en/server-configuration-defaults.html # *** D

win安装Theano

艰辛的安装Theano过程,把其中遇到的问题记录下来,三台机子都尝试了安装Theao,系统分别为:A机:win7 64-bit(笔记本).B机:win7 64-bit(台式机).C机:win8 64-bit(虽然前面两台机子的系统一样,但是安装过程中出的问题不一样). 首先参考了博客: http://blog.sina.com.cn/s/blog_96b836170102vq22.html http://blog.csdn.net/niuwei22007/article/details/4768

win 安装 php redis 扩展

1 . 首先通过 phpinfo() 函数 查看php 环境 我的如下 通过这个网址查看相应的版本下载下来:http://windows.php.net/downloads/pecl/snaps/redis/2.2.5/ 选择下载 : 解压得到内容: 将php_redis.dll 放到 php ext 扩展目录 同时 在php.ini 添加一行 extension=php_redis.dll 重启  服务器 安装成功